Mumbai, Nov 28 (PTI) The benchmark Sensex gained for the first time in three days and closed 115 points higher today, led by heavyweight Reliance Industries, as Asian and European stock markets advanced amid optimism about the US economy.
The index dipped briefly towards the end of the session before recovering. There was some selling on the expiry of futures and options (F&O) contracts and some cautious investors booked profits ahead of GDP and fiscal deficit data due tomorrow.
